Requirements
  • MD, Ph.D. or terminal doctoral degree in relevant field
  • Proficiency in Python, and/or R statistical package
  • Proficiency in using LLM, model training, and Generative AI
  • Experience with supervised and unsupervised ML techniques
  • Skill in collecting, organizing, and analyzing data
  • Ability to recognize, analyze, and solve a variety of problem
  • Ability to exercise sound judgment in making critical decisions
  • Ability to work independently and reliably with different academic teams
Responsibilities
  • Assists in planning and designing research experiments, establishes priorities, and recommends schedules.
  • Presents research findings at local and national scientific conferences.
  • Writes technical publications and reports.
  • Designs and writes programs to perform analysis and produces written reports on results.
  • Collects pilot data to help support new and competing renewal applications.
  • Supervises undergraduate and graduate research students and performs literature reviews.
  • Adheres to University and unit-level policies and procedures and safeguards University assets.
  • Support the development of new AI-driven curricula and assessment frameworks for health professions education.
  • Design, develop and apply AI solutions including traditional machine learning models, natural language processing (NLP), and ontology-based frameworks to enhance simulation, curriculum development, and personalized learning in health professions education
  • Develop and evaluate AI-powered tools such as chatbots, automated feedback systems, and adaptive and precision learning pathways, to enhance student engagement, knowledge retention, and competency-based education.
  • Conduct cutting-edge research in AI-enhanced educational methodologies, data analytics, and digital learning platforms
  • Lead and contribute to grant proposals and peer-reviewed publications to secure funding and disseminate findings focused on AI and informatics-driven educational innovations.
  • Integrate large-scale educational and clinical datasets into AI-driven learning systems to improve decision-making and training efficacy using best practices in information systems management.
  • Create, implement and evaluate the impact of AI-enhanced generative assessment tools to enhance simulation-based training, virtual patients, and decision support systems to ensure real-time skill development in clinical education.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ams across the Miller School of Medicine, UHealth, and industry partners to co-design and pilot new AI-driven curricula and educational technologies across the medical school and health system.
  • Contribute to the development of institutional policy, ethical frameworks, and best practices related to the use of AI in medical education.
  • Establish an independent research agenda under the mentorship of faculty from both departments, aligned with the university’s strategic vision for AI-powered medical education.
